The software development landscape has undergone significant transformations as Artificial Intelligence continues to play an influential role. During a notable tech conference, industry giants like Meta’s Mark Zuckerberg and Microsoft’s Satya Nadella emphasized AI’s escalating impact on coding processes, sparking both excitement and concern. At Microsoft, AI agents now contribute to 30% of the code in GitHub repositories, signifying an increased reliance on AI-driven coding tools. This shift towards AI in development is not limited to coding alone; it reflects a broader trend in optimizing various business operations. This evolving dynamic raises critical questions about the future roles of human programmers. The growing integration of AI in software development could redefine the traditional job descriptions and skill sets of coding professionals, marking an era where AI may potentially outpace human competencies in certain technological feats.

AI’s Role in Transforming Software Development

In the dynamic world of technology, AI is increasingly integral to development tools, changing how software projects come to life. Zuckerberg aims to boost Meta’s engagement through aggressive AI implementation, potentially transforming user experiences and enhancing revenue via smart advertising. As AI agents advance, they’re expected to match the skills of mid-level engineers. At Meta, this is the dawn of AI-led research, minimizing human involvement in technical areas. However, this shift to AI-centric processes presents challenges. Programmers might find themselves sidelined, focusing more on oversight than active coding, potentially undermining human coding skill development. As businesses chase higher returns, AI agents may become as common as email in operational roles, far beyond just coding. Insights from leaders like Zuckerberg and Nadella point to AI’s dominance over various business functions, sparking debates on the sustainability of an AI-driven industry.

While AI offers exciting benefits, it also poses challenges requiring careful thought. Embracing AI must balance maintaining human creativity and intuition in software development. As the industry progresses, fostering environments where AI complements rather than replaces human skills will be vital.
